Intercontinental Exchange Expects 2Q Recurring Revenues of $844 Million to $859 Million

Intercontinental Exchange Inc. said it expects recurring
revenues for the second quarter of $844 million to $859
million.
The New York Stock Exchange operator on Thursday said it expects
operating expenses in a range of $895 million to $905 million for
the quarter, or $742 million to $752 million on an adjusted
basis.
It forecast non-operating expenses of $97 million to $102
million for the quarter, or $105 million to $110 million on an
adjusted basis.
The company said it expects full-year operating expenses or
$3.545 billion to $3.595 billion, or $2.88 billion to $2.93 billion
on an adjusted basis.
